During my three and a half years at St Andrews, I have been continually mystified by the entire grading system and what my results actually mean. Grades are awarded on a curved scale from 0 (useless) to 20 (amazing), with 5 being a pass. That's simple enough, but even though a 5 is a pass it's still a pretty poor grade, and an 11 is apparently the minimum that most people should be aiming for.
